Hi Judy,

I'm glad you have rejoined the group. I think all of us from time to time feel the need to take a little break, it can get all consuming and overwhelming. Sometimes we all need to think about something else, right?

What you posted about showering got my attention. It was in rehab almost two years ago that the physical therapist told me to get a shower chair. I resisted, thought it was ridiculous and was mildly insulted. I was 47 years old, why on e arth should I need a shower chair. Well thankfully my sister tuned out my nonsensical ravings and went out and bought me a shower chair. Now I'd marry the thing if I could. It makes taking a shower a pleasure again. Also I hope you're taking the O2 in the shower with you. And you might consider turning it up while you're in there, my sats drop while I'm showering so I turn it up to 5 or 5.5 and then turn it down when I get out. Rehab is so important, don't give up!

hi everyone

i haven't been here for quite some time. i joined the group and loved it, especially the kindness of everyone. however, i found it was making me feel a little depressed. i was so happy to read about all the things i had questions about, but with it also came the reality. thing is, i thought i was dealing with it very well. i guess that was the biggest shock! i was in denial but knew all the right things to say to fool myself and others. anyway, i am in a better place now regarding that.

i've done some declining since last here. my ox sats drop rapidly to low 70's as soon as i stand or walk. i am on 3l sitting and 4-5 when standing. as you know, it drops and the heart pounds away. presently, i am on 10 mg. prednisone, revatio 3x day, and metformin. oh yeah, i developed pulmonary hypertension and diabetes from the prednisone. but, i lost 20 lbs!! yay..right? well, you can't tell of course having the prednisone bulge! my cough started to get alot worse and i took an antibiotic for a week and my pred. was upped to 20 for a week. it improved, but about three days later, cough came back. now i need to up it again back to 20 for 2 weeks. i didn't contact my dr. this time because i know that's what he'd say. i get discouraged because my mind feels normal and i want to do more to help myself. thing is, basically i sit here at the computer or nap. not much socialization but i am thankful to be alive and every day is a gift. i was in

rehab but had to stop because getting showered and out three times a week was just too much. does anyone else find showering such a tedious chore? i've actually resolved myself to being smelly! always use to be very clean..now i let a day or two go by, always telling myself..tomorrow. and i hate watching my husband do MY housework! i remember well hating housework..until i could no longer do it..now i miss it and find myself resenting him for it. i think caregivers have it rough, but being the one being tended to is harder, don't you think?
